How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ruskin Colony Farms?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ruskin Colony Farms 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,740 | $1,493 | $2,220 |
| Ruskin Colony Farms 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,121 | $1,852 | $2,527 |
| Ruskin Colony Farms 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,306 | $2,137 | $2,592 |
| Ruskin Colony Farms 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,251 | $2,251 | $2,251 |

How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
